Summary
- Dr. Albert Weihl II is a retired emergency medicine physician based in Avon, CO. He completed his medical education at Yale School of Medicine, followed by a residency in Internal Medicine at Yale-New Haven Medical Center and Massachusetts General Hospital. Dr. Weihl also pursued a fellowship in Endocrinology, Diabetes, and Metabolism at Massachusetts General Hospital. He has served as an attending Emergency Department physician at Vail Health and Yale-New Haven Hospital. One of his notable publications is on thyroid function tests during subacute thyroiditis, which has been cited 41 times.
